免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发前端开发工程师

App开发前端开发工程师是指负责开发移动应用程序用户界面的专业人员。他们使用各种前端开发技术和工具,如HTML、CSS和JavaScript,来创建用户友好的界面,使用户能够直观地与应用程序进行交互。

在进行App开发前端开发工作之前,了解一些基本概念和原理是非常重要的。下面将详细介绍一些常见的前端开发原理和技术。

1. HTML:HTML(超文本标记语言)是一种用于创建网页结构的标记语言。它由一系列的标签组成,每个标签用于定义页面上的不同元素,如标题、段落、图像等。前端开发工程师使用HTML来构建应用程序的用户界面。

2. CSS:CSS(层叠样式表)是一种用于描述网页样式的语言。通过使用CSS,前端开发工程师可以定义页面的布局、颜色、字体、大小等样式。CSS具有层叠性,可以将多个样式应用到同一个元素上,并按照一定的优先级进行显示。

3. JavaScript:JavaScript是一种用于开发动态网页和交互式应用程序的脚本语言。它可以在网页上执行各种操作,如表单验证、动态内容更新和用户交互等。前端开发工程师使用JavaScript来实现应用程序的逻辑和交互功能。

4. 响应式设计:响应式设计是一种设计方法,旨在使网页在不同设备上都能够自适应地显示。前端开发工程师使用响应式设计来确保应用程序在各种屏幕尺寸和设备上都能够良好地显示和操作。

5. 前端框架:前端框架是一组预先定义好的代码和规范,用于简化前端开发工作。常见的前端框架包括React、Angular和Vue.js等。前端开发工程师可以使用这些框架来快速构建应用程序,并提供一些常用的功能和组件。

6. 浏览器兼容性:不同的浏览器对HTML、CSS和JavaScript的解析和渲染方式可能有所不同。前端开发工程师需要考虑不同浏览器的兼容性,并确保应用程序在各种浏览器上都能够正常运行。

7. 性能优化:性能优化是指通过优化代码和资源加载等方式,提高应用程序的运行速度和响应能力。前端开发工程师可以使用一些技术,如压缩和合并文件、使用缓存、异步加载等,来优化应用程序的性能。

总结起来,App开发前端开发工程师需要掌握HTML、CSS和JavaScript等前端开发技术,了解响应式设计、前端框架和浏览器兼容性等相关知识,并能够进行性能优化。通过熟练掌握这些原理和技术,前端开发工程师可以创建出用户友好、高性能的移动应用程序界面。


相关知识:
山海经异变软件app开发
山海经异变软件app是一款基于山海经的文化IP开发的移动应用软件。它将山海经中的各种神话、传说、怪兽等进行了深度挖掘和整合,以特定的方式呈现给用户。该软件的主要目的是让用户更好地了解和学习山海经中的文化知识,同时也能够在娱乐中感受到文化的魅力。该软件主要的
2024-01-10
如何开发软件app赚钱
开发软件App赚钱的原理就是通过开发具有实用价值或娱乐价值的应用程序,向用户提供有偿的服务或商品,从而获得利润。以下是详细介绍:1. 确定目标市场和受众群体在开发一个软件App之前,首先需要确定目标市场和受众群体。这有助于开发者更好地了解用户需求,为用户提
2024-01-10
app软件是用什么语言开发的
App软件的开发可以使用多种语言进行,其中最常见的包括Java、Swift、Objective-C、C#、Python等。不同的语言适用于不同的平台和需求,下面将对其中几种常见的语言进行详细介绍。1. Java:Java是一种跨平台的编程语言,最常用于开发
2023-06-29
app开发平台源码相关优惠价格
标题:app开发平台源码相关优惠价格(原理或详细介绍)正文:在移动互联网快速发展的今天,开发一个自己的手机应用程序成为了越来越多人的需求。为了满足用户的需求,出现了许多app开发平台,这些平台提供了一站式的解决方案,方便开发者快速开发和发布自己的应用程序。
2023-06-29
app电商平台首页h5开发
app电商平台首页是电商平台中最重要的一个页面,在这个页面中可以展示电商平台的优势和特色,吸引用户进入平台浏览和购买商品。在网站开发的初期就应该注重首页开发,设计好首页布局和内容,为用户呈现一个良好的购物体验。HTML5是当前比较流行的网页开发技术之一,其
2023-05-06
app定制开发服务哪家更好
随着智能手机的普及,移动应用行业越来越活跃。许多企业和创业公司都下注于移动应用开发。但是,对于一些企业来说,利用移动应用程序进行业务发展并不是它们所熟悉的领域,因此需要找到一家合适的第三方公司来提供app定制开发服务。那么,哪家公司提供更好的app定制开发
2023-05-06